MirrorLinkTM smartphone connection
Audio and Telematics
Page 383 of 516

383
As a safety measure and because it requires the sustained attention of the driver, using a smartphone when driving is prohibited.Operation must be with the vehicle stationary.
The synchronisation of a smartphone allows applications on a smartphone that are adapted to the MirrorLinkTM technology to be displayed in the vehicle's screen.The principles and standards are constantly evolving. For the communication process between the smartphone and the system to work correctly, the smartphone must be unlocked; update the operating system of your smar tphone as well as the date and time in the smartphone and the system.For the list of eligible smartphones, connect to the brand's internet website in your country.
The "MirrorLinkTM" function requires the use of a compatible smartphone
and applications.
There may be a wait for the availability of applications, depending on the quality of your network.
When connecting a smartphone to the system, it is recommended that Bluetooth® be started on the smartphone
Depending on the smartphone, it may be necessary to activate the "MirrorLinkTM" function.
During the procedure, several screen pages relating to certain functions are displayed.Accept to start and end the connection.
Connect a USB cable. The smartphone charges when connected by a USB cable.
Press "MirrorLinkTM" to start the application in the system.
Once connection is established, a page is displayed with the applications already downloaded to your smartphone and adapted to MirrorLinkTM technology.
Access to the different audio sources remains accessible in the margin of the MirrorLinkTM display, using touch buttons in the upper bar.Access to the menus for the system is possible at any time using the dedicated buttons
From the system, press on "Connectivity to display the primary page.
As a safety measure, applications can only be viewed with the vehicle stationary; display is interrupted once the vehicle is moving.

Select the audio source (depending on version):- FM / DAB* / AM* stations.- Smartphone via MirrorLinkTM.- USB memory stick.- Media player connected to the auxiliary socket (jack, cable not supplied).- Telephone connected by Bluetooth* and using Bluetooth* audio streaming.
* Depending on equipment.
Short-cuts: using the virtual buttons in the upper band of touch screen, it is possible to go directly to the selection of audio source, the list of stations (or titles, depending on the source), message notifications and emails.
In very hot conditions, the volume may be limited to protect the system. It may go into standby (screen and sound off) for at least 5 minutesThe return to normal takes place when the temperature in the passenger compartment drops.
In the "Settings" menu you can create a profile for just one person or a group of people with common points, with the possibility of entering a multitude of settings (radio presets, audio settings, contact favourites, ...); these settings are taken into account automatically.
